NOTE:

Many disk diagnostic programs can cause the above warning message to

appear when the program attempts to access the boot sector table. If you

will be running such a program, it is recommended that you first disable the

virus protection function before hand.

CPU Internal (L1 & L2) Cache [Enabled]

The CPU L1 & L2 Cache option allows users to select whether the CPU primary cache (L1) and

secondary cache (L2) will be turned on or off.

Enabled

(D

EFAULT

)

The L1 and L2 CPU caches are both turned on

Disabled

The L1 and L2 CPU caches are both turned off
